A STUDY ON A LABOR SAVING OIL RECOVERY SYSTEM TO REMOVE VISCOUS OIL FROM THE WATER SURFACE IN FRONT OF THE BEACH

Abstract
The oil spill accident of Nakhodka in 1997 made many persons (around 400 to 500 thousands) work hard to remove emulsified heavy oil to clean the coasts. They suffered from viscous oil because the conventional oil recovery equipment was not good for the oil of such viscosity of 500Pa·s. They had to use dippers and buckets by their own labor, because the access of heavy machinery to the coast from land or sea was difficult due to irregular terrain conditions and shallow water depth. This paper describes a labor saving oil recovery system for viscous heavy oil on the water surface in front of the beach. The system is able to skim oil from water/oil mixture which contains emulsified heavy oil. It is also able to transport separated oil for long distance without blockade. The performance of the system is equivalent to 150 persons while only 10 persons are necessary for operation. These results have been confirmed by pool test using emulsified heavy oil and operation test at sea.
